Quaternium-80

Other names: Siloxanes and Silicones

Harm score: 3 (Harmless chemicals)


Quaternium-80, also known as Siloxanes and Silicones, is a widely used chemical ingredient in cosmetic and pharmaceutical manufacturing. It is a surfactant with numerous applications outside these fields. Quaternium-80 is a specific silicone that has a quaternary, or fourth level ammonium compound. It contains four organic groups attached to a central nitrogen atom and is particularly effective in conditioning and softening hair when applied for better detangling. Its essential properties are its ability to form a protective film and reduce static electricity.

In the pharmaceutical industry, Quaternium-80 is used as an excipient, which is an excipient used in the manufacture of drugs. In the cosmetics sector, it can be found in many types of products - a wide range of shampoos, conditioners and hair sprays, but also skin and body creams, shower gels, bath foams, depilatory creams, sunscreens and cosmetics for children. Its ability to form a protective film on the skin or hair makes it an ideal ingredient in products designed to moisturise and protect the skin and hair. It is also favourably evaluated for its ease of removal and its ability to leave the skin smooth and soft.
